Holston Anesthesia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Holston Anesthesia in the United States is $71,073.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$34. Salaries at Holston Anesthesia typically range from $62,436 to $80,808 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Kingsport?

Understanding the cost of living near Kingsport is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Holston Anesthesia.
Kingsport's Cost of Living Index is approximately 82.3 (17.7% less expensive than US average; 8.8% less than TN average). Tri-Cities area, Eastman Chemical, affordable. KATS. When planning your budget based on a salary from Holston Anesthesia, consider these typical monthly expenses:
